Why My RV 50Amp Power Cord Is Necessary

When I first started RVing, I quickly realized how important having a reliable 50Amp power cord is. My RV relies on a 50Amp power source to run multiple appliances and systems simultaneously, from the air conditioning to the microwave and the water heater. Without the proper cord, I wouldn’t be able to access the full power supply at many campgrounds, which limits my comfort and convenience.

Another reason I find my 50Amp power cord necessary is safety. Using the correct gauge and type of cord designed for 50Amp service ensures that I avoid overheating or electrical faults. This peace of mind is crucial, especially when I’m parked in remote locations or during extreme weather conditions. In short, my 50Amp power cord keeps my RV powered efficiently and safely, making every trip smoother and more enjoyable.

My Buying Guide on RV 50Amp Power Cord

When I first started looking for an RV 50Amp power cord, I realized there are several important factors to consider to ensure safety, reliability, and convenience. Here’s what I’ve learned from my experience that might help you choose the best power cord for your needs.

Understanding the 50Amp Power Cord

A 50Amp power cord is designed to handle higher electrical loads, typically needed for larger RVs with more appliances and systems. It’s different from the common 30Amp cord because it delivers more power, allowing you to run multiple devices without tripping breakers.

Length of the Cord

I found that the length of the cord is crucial. Too short, and you might struggle to reach the power pedestal at the campground. Too long, and it becomes bulky and harder to manage. I recommend measuring the distance from your RV’s inlet to the typical power source you use and then adding a little extra length for flexibility. Common lengths are between 25 to 50 feet.

Wire Gauge and Build Quality

The thickness of the wire (measured in gauge) affects the cord’s ability to safely carry power without overheating. For a 50Amp cord, a 6-gauge wire is standard and offers a good balance between flexibility and durability. I always look for cords with heavy-duty insulation and robust connectors to withstand outdoor conditions.

Connector Type and Compatibility

Make sure the cord’s connectors match your RV and the power source. A standard 50Amp RV power cord has a NEMA 14-50 plug on one end (to connect to the power pedestal) and a female inlet on the other (to connect to your RV). I double-check the pins and shape to avoid any mismatches.

Safety Features

Safety is paramount. I look for cords with features like strain reliefs on the connectors to prevent damage from bending, and weather-resistant materials to protect against rain, dust, and UV rays. Some cords even come with built-in circuit breakers or surge protection, which can be a bonus.

Portability and Storage

Since I’m often on the move, I prefer cords that are easy to coil and store without tangling. Some come with storage bags or reels, which help keep things organized and extend the life of the cord.

Price vs. Quality

While it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, I learned that investing a bit more in a reputable brand and quality materials pays off. A good cord lasts longer, is safer, and provides peace of mind during my travels.
